Latest Patents

Lulejian holds a patent for "Methods and instruments for materials testing." This invention involves methods and instruments designed to characterize materials by using a test probe that can be inserted into the material. The system includes a reference probe that is aligned with the test probe within a handheld housing. This setup allows for precise evaluation of material properties related to indentation, which is crucial for understanding the characteristics of materials like bone.
